Title: BIM Records Librarian Location: UT-Salt Lake City Hybrid Work Job Description: Job Description: The BIM Records Librarian is responsible for developing, implementing, and maintaining Intermountain Health’s enterprise-wide electronic plan room system. This role ensures centralized access to accurate, up-to-date facility documentation—including AutoCAD and Revit drawings, BIM models, life safety plans, specifications, and square footage data. By combining advanced digital librarianship with technical fluency in design applications, the BIM Records Librarian acts as the steward of a “single source of truth” for built environment data, supporting Real Estate, Facilities, Design & Construction, and regulatory compliance efforts. Essential Functions Plan Room Oversight: Build and maintain electronic plan rooms across all Intermountain regions using Autodesk and Trimble Unity Construct platforms. Record Document Management: Acquire, catalog, and maintain AutoCAD/Revit record drawings, BIM models, and space data; ensure standards for document quality, version control, and accessibility. System Integration: Collaborate with PMIS and Power BI teams to streamline facility data across platforms and reduce software redundancy and licensing costs. Training & Support: Provide training, resources, and user support to Real Estate, Facilities, and project teams on BIM and document management protocols. Collaboration: Interface across departments (Design & Construction, Real Estate, Facilities, Strategy, Environmental Services) to provide timely access to accurate facility models and support lifecycle project needs. Regulatory Readiness: Ensure documentation readiness for audits and surveys (e.g., The Joint Commission) by maintaining up-to-date life safety drawings and other required plans. Standards Development: Assist in the development and enforcement of enterprise design and BIM standards, metadata schemas, and documentation guidelines. Continuous Improvement: Recommend and implement process improvements, system upgrades, and documentation workflows aligned with industry best practices.
